WebDebits and credits are terms used by bookkeepers and accountants when recording transactions in the accounting records. The amount in every transaction must be entered in one account as a debit (left side of the account) and in another account as a credit (right side of the account). WebApr 28, 2024 · Accounts receivable: The amount that your customers owe you after buying your goods or services on credit. Inventory: Items purchased for resale to customers. Prepaid expenses: Expenses you’ve paid in advance, such as six months of insurance premiums. Investments: Money-market account balances, stocks, and bonds.
